Swiss Franc Gains as Safe Haven Asset

The Swiss Franc has seen gains as investors seek safe-haven assets amidst global economic uncertainty. Increased demand reflects concerns over the stability of other currencies and markets. Switzerland’s stable economy and financial system support the Franc’s appeal.

The Swiss Franc is experiencing increased demand as a safe-haven asset, driven by global economic anxieties. Investors are turning to the Franc due to its perceived stability during times of market volatility and currency fluctuations.

Factors Contributing to the Franc’s Strength

  • Economic Stability: Switzerland’s robust and stable economy provides a solid foundation for its currency.
  • Financial System: The Swiss financial system is known for its security and reliability, attracting investors seeking a safe place to park their assets.
  • Political Neutrality: Switzerland’s long-standing policy of political neutrality further enhances its appeal as a safe haven.

Impact on the Swiss Economy

While a strong Franc can be beneficial in terms of maintaining price stability and reducing import costs, it can also pose challenges for Swiss exporters. A stronger currency makes Swiss goods and services more expensive for foreign buyers, potentially impacting competitiveness.

Analyst Commentary

Analysts suggest that the Franc’s strength is likely to persist as long as global economic uncertainty remains elevated. However, interventions by the Swiss National Bank (SNB) could potentially moderate the currency’s appreciation.

Potential Risks

Despite its safe-haven status, the Franc is not immune to risks. Unexpected economic shocks or shifts in global investor sentiment could lead to fluctuations in its value.
